It’s a state of incredible diversity, from the bustling metropolis of Los Angeles to the laid-back vibes of San Francisco. But with that diversity comes a wide range of prices.

Accommodation: Think of hotels as California’s version of designer clothes – they can be incredibly expensive, but there are also some great deals to be found. Hostels and camping are your budget-friendly options, while luxury hotels and beachfront villas will set you back a pretty penny.

Food: California cuisine is a melting pot of flavors, but it can also be a melting pot for your wallet. There are plenty of affordable options, like food trucks and farmer’s markets, but if you're craving Michelin-star dining, be prepared to open your wallet wider than a California redwoods tree.

Transportation: Renting a car is a popular option, but gas prices can be higher than in other states. Public transportation is available in major cities, but it might not be as extensive as you’re used to. And if you want to experience the full California dream, consider renting a convertible – just be prepared to pay through the nose for gas and parking.

Attractions: California is packed with things to do, but many of them come with a price tag. Theme parks, museums, and outdoor activities can add up quickly. However, there are also plenty of free or low-cost options, like hiking, beachcombing, and people-watching.

How to Make Your California Dream a Reality

So, how much does a California vacation actually cost? The short answer is: it depends. Your budget will determine where you stay, what you eat, and what you do. But with a little planning, you can enjoy the Golden State without breaking the bank.

Here are some tips to help you save:

  • Off-peak travel: Visit California during the shoulder seasons (spring and fall) to avoid crowds and higher prices.
  • Cook your own meals: Save money by staying in accommodations with kitchen facilities and cooking your own meals.
  • Free activities: Take advantage of California’s natural beauty by hiking, biking, and exploring the outdoors for free.
  • Use public transportation: Save money on transportation costs by using public transportation whenever possible.
  • Look for deals: Keep an eye out for deals on flights, hotels, and attractions.
